Gregg Distributors Midget AAA

Mission Statement: We strive to provide and environment that encourages development that not only addresses the attainment of hockey skill and knowledge but also keys on positive character growth. By doing this we provide the platform for every player to have an opportunity to step to the next level in the hockey progression.

League: AMHL - premiere midget hockey league in North America.

Season Highlights: 34 league games plus playoffs culminating in a trip to the National Midget AAA Championship Telus Cup.

- Macs Invitational Midget AAA Hockey Tournament in December.

Coaches:

Guy Paradis (HC) - 25 years of head and assistant coaching experience. Currently entering the fourth season as HC with Gregg Distributors (2014/15 AMHL North Division Champions, 2014/15 Glen Sather Award recipient for AMHL Coach of the Year). 5 years coaching experience in the AJHL with the St Albert Saints and the Sherwood Park Crusaders (1995/96 AJHL Champions, Doyle Cup finalist - St. Albert Saints). 5 seasons with Stony Plain Eagles Sr. AAA as a playing head coach (Hardy Cup Champions 91/92, 92/93, 93/94, 94/95, Allan Cup Champion 99). Inducted into the Alberta Sports Hall of Fame in 2007 as a member of the 1999 Stony Plain Eagles Allan Cup Champions. Playing history - SJHL, WHL, WIHL and 5 seasons with the University of Alberta Golden Bears (National Champions 85/85, Canada West Champions 88/89, 90/91). Coach mentor for Hockey Alberta Futures Leaders Program.

Shawn Thomson (AC) - Shawn played Bantam AAA for CAC in minor hockey. His junior career starting with the Junior B Warriors, playing 2 seasons and winning cities the first year. He then moved to the Junior B Red Wings for a season and a half. Shawn was also a referee for 7 years at the Midget AA level. For the last 5 years Shawn have been coaching and training, the last 3 years have been with CAC Midget AAA.

Bradley Matsuba(AC) - The upcoming 2016-17 season will be my fourth year coaching at the Canadian Athletic Club, and third year coaching in the AMHL with the Gregg Distributors as an Assistant Coach. Prior, I was an Assistant Coach at Bantam AA with Alberta Honda. During this tenure I have obtained my Respect in Sport and Development I certifications. Growing up, Brad played house league for various teams including the Garrison Warriors and Northeast Zone. Noted accomplishments during his playing career include two minor hockey week championships, a city championship and a Wayne Gretzky Award which was awarded in 2009 during my final year of midget hockey.

Kurtis Mucha (AC- Goalie) - Kurtis grew up in the Sherwood Park hockey system before eventually moving on to play for the Portland Winter Hawks and Kamloops Blazers of the Western Hockey League. After a successful junior career and a couple NHL main camps, Kurtis decided to use his WHL scholarship package and play at the University of Alberta with the Golden Bears. Kurtis enjoyed some personal success with the Bears but more importantly team success in winning 4 Canada West league

championships, and 2 national championships. After finishing with the Golden Bears, Kurtis made the transition into coaching after receiving the opportunity to work for the Edmonton Oil Kings of the WHL. Outside of the Oil Kings, Kurtis currently works with the Spruce Grove Saints and Sherwood Park Crusaders of the AJHL, and a few local AAA teams as well. Kurtis is looking forward to the opportunity in working with the CAC Gregg Distributors under Guy Paradis this upcoming season.

Off Ice Training: Addressing balance, mobility, flexibility, agility stamina and strength.

Bree Guhle (Joga Instructor) - Bree studied kinesiology before attending her Registered Yoga Teacher Training 200 hr, once she completed her certification she went on to discover Joga, which she knew right away was exactly what she wanted to do. She is now a Master Joga Trainer in Edmonton, Alberta. Bree has worked with CAC for two years and more specifically Gregg Distributors, teaching the hockey players Joga. They have learnt the value of stretching and how to stretch properly for their bodies. Bree works with many professional athletes in hockey, football, and basketball within the city. The highlight of her career so far was working with the Edmonton Eskimos in their 2015 Grey Cup season. In the future she sees herself travelling around teaching Joga to professional athletes and teams outside of Canada!
